Not All the Blood of Beasts

Author: Isaac Watts Hymnal: Trinity Hymnal (Rev. ed.) #242 (1990) Meter: 6.6.8.6 Topics: Imputation of Sin Lyrics: 1 Not all the blood of beasts on Jewish altars slain, could give the guilty conscience peace, or wash away the stain: 2 But Christ, the heav'nly Lamb, takes all our sins away, a sacrifice of nobler name and richer blood than they. 3 My faith would lay her hand on that dear head of thine, while like a penitent I stand, and there confess my sin. 4 My soul looks back to see the burdens thou didst bear, when hanging on the cursed tree, and knows her guilt was there. 5 Believing, we rejoice to see the curse remove; we bless the Lamb with cheerful voice, and sing his bleeding love. Scripture: Hebrews 10:4 Languages: English Tune Title: FESTAL SONG

O Sacred Head, Now Wounded

Author: Bernard of Clairvaux, 1091-1153; Paul Gerhardt; James W. Alexander Hymnal: Trinity Hymnal (Rev. ed.) #247 (1990) Meter: 7.6.7.6 D Topics: Imputation of Sin Lyrics: 1 O sacred Head, now wounded, with grief and shame weighed down; now scornfully surrounded with thorns, thine only crown; O sacred Head, what glory, what bliss till now was thine! Yet, though despised and gory, I joy to call thee mine. 2 What thou, my Lord, hast suffered was all for sinners' gain: mine, mine was the transgression, but thine the deadly pain. Lo, here I fall, my Savior! 'Tis I deserve thy place; look on me with thy favor, vouchsafe to me thy grace. 3 What language shall I borrow to thank thee, dearest Friend, for this, thy dying sorrow, thy pity without end? O make me thine forever; and should I fainting be, Lord, let me never, never outlive my love to thee. Scripture: Isaiah 53:5 Languages: English Tune Title: PASSION CHORALE

Ah, Holy Jesus, How Hast Thou Offended

Author: Johann Heermann Hymnal: Trinity Hymnal (Rev. ed.) #248 (1990) Meter: 11.11.11.5 Topics: Imputation of Sin Lyrics: 1 Ah, holy Jesus, how hast thou offended, that man to judge thee hath in hate pretended? By foes derided, by thine own rejected, O most afflicted. 2 Who was the guilty who brought this upon thee? Alas, my treason, Jesus, hath undone thee. 'Twas I, Lord Jesus, I it was denied thee: I crucified thee. 3 Lo, the Good Shepherd for the sheep is offered: the slave hath sinned, and the Son hath suffered: for man's atonement, while he nothing heedeth, God intercedeth. 4 For me, kind Jesus, was thine incarnation, thy mortal sorrow, and thy life's oblation: thy death of anguish and thy bitter passion, for my salvation. 5 Therefore, kind Jesus, since I cannot pay thee, I do adore thee, and will ever pray thee, think on thy pity and thy love unswerving, not my deserving. Scripture: Isaiah 53:4 Languages: English Tune Title: HERZLIEBSTER JESU

Alas! And Did My Savior Bleed

Author: Isaac Watts Hymnal: Trinity Hymnal (Rev. ed.) #254 (1990) Meter: 8.6.8.6 Topics: Imputation of Sin Lyrics: 1 Alas! and did my Savior bleed, and did my Sovereign die! Would he devote that sacred head for such a worm as I! 2 Was it for crimes that I had done he groaned upon the tree! Amazing pity! Grace unknown! And love beyond degree! 3 Well might the sun in darkness hide, and shut his glories in, when Christ, the mighty Maker, died for man the creature's sin. 4 Thus might I hide my blushing face while his dear cross appears; dissolve my heart in thankfulness, and melt mine eyes in tears. 5 But drops of grief can ne'er repay the debt of love I owe; here, Lord, I give myself away, 'tis all that I can do. Scripture: Isaiah 53:5 Languages: English Tune Title: MARTYRDOM
